View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window artemis4j-6.6.6.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
edu.kit.kastel.sdq.artemis4j.grading.model.rule
├─ edu.kit.kastel.sdq.artemis4j.grading.model.rule.CustomPenaltyRule.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.model.rule.PenaltyRule.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.model.rule.StackingPenaltyRule.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.model.rule.ThresholdPenaltyRule.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api.grading
├─ edu.kit.kastel.sdq.artemis4j.api.grading.IAnnotation.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.grading.IMistakeType.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.grading.IRatingGroup.class - [JAR]
edu.kit.kastel.sdq.artemis4j.util
├─ edu.kit.kastel.sdq.artemis4j.util.Pair.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.util.Version.class - [JAR]
edu.kit.kastel.sdq.artemis4j.grading.model.annotation
├─ edu.kit.kastel.sdq.artemis4j.grading.model.annotation.Annotation.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.model.annotation.AnnotationException.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.model.annotation.AnnotationManagement.class - [JAR]
edu.kit.kastel.sdq.artemis4j.grading.config
├─ edu.kit.kastel.sdq.artemis4j.grading.config.ExerciseConfig.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.config.ExerciseConfigConverter.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.config.GradingConfig.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.config.JsonFileConfig.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.config.PenaltyRuleDeserializer.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.config.PenaltyRuleType.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api.artemis.stats
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.stats.Stats.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.stats.Timing.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api.artemis.assessment
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.AssessmentResult.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.Feedback.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.FeedbackType.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.LockCallAssessmentResult.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.LockResult.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.Participation.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.Result.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.Submission.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.assessment.TestCase.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api.client
├─ edu.kit.kastel.sdq.artemis4j.api.client.IAssessmentAr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.client.IAuthenticationAr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.client.ICourseAr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.client.IExamAr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.client.ISubmissionsAr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.client.IUtilArtemisClient.class - [JAR]
edu.kit.kastel.sdq.artemis4j.client
├─ edu.kit.kastel.sdq.artemis4j.client.AbstractAr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.AssessmentAr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.ExamAr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.LoginManager.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.MappingLoaderAr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.RestClientManager.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.SubmissionsArtemisClient.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.client.UtilArtemisClient.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api.artemis.exam
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.exam.Exam.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.exam.ExerciseGroup.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.exam.StudentExam.class - [JAR]
edu.kit.kastel.sdq.artemis4j.grading.artemis
├─ edu.kit.kastel.sdq.artemis4j.grading.artemis.AnnotationDeserializer.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.artemis.AnnotationMapper.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api
├─ edu.kit.kastel.sdq.artemis4j.api.ArtemisClientException.class - [JAR]
edu.kit.kastel.sdq.artemis4j.api.artemis
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.Course.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.Exercise.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.ExerciseStats.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.IMappingLoader.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.api.artemis.User.class - [JAR]
edu.kit.kastel.sdq.artemis4j.grading.model
├─ edu.kit.kastel.sdq.artemis4j.grading.model.MistakeType.class - [JAR]
├─ edu.kit.kastel.sdq.artemis4j.grading.model.RatingGroup.class - [JAR]